Marissa Christine Stough, 20, of Lebanon, formerly of Palmyra, was tragically lost from our world on Monday, Christmas Day 2023 as a result of an automobile accident.  She was born in York, PA to Marcy C. Stough of Millsboro, DE, formerly of Palmyra, on Tuesday, June 17, 2003.

She graduated from Palmyra Area High School in 2021 where she played goalie for the varsity field hockey and lacrosse teams.  She followed her passion and graduated from Empire Beauty School in January 2023 and began working as an aesthetician for Kat Eye Beauty in Lebanon.  She was extremely hard working, juggling three jobs to ensure she could pursue her dreams and goals.  She began working at The Sinkhole Saloon & Grill and Palmyra Bowling at the age of fourteen, most notably known as a server to patrons, and was still an active part of operations.  She was vibrant and full of life, always present with a larger than life smile and her “friendly Marissa wave” sometimes using both hands!  Selfless, independent, giving and a lover of children—a beautiful soul gone, leaving an immeasurable void for all who knew her.

She is survived by her loving mother, Marcy C. Stough and wife Karie A. Stough of Millsboro, DE; five sisters, Mariah Hunter and significant other Jarrod Musko of Lebanon, Makenna Stough of Millsboro, DE, Melania, Maggie and Marleigh; maternal grandmother, Deborah Stough of Lebanon; maternal great-grandmother, Joann Warfel of York; and numerous other family and extended family.  She was predeceased by her maternal grandfather, Mark Stough.
